The Stingray sculpture awareness public art idea is a project close to my heart. Having witnessed countless individuals, including myself, being stung by rays along our beaches, I am driven to raise awareness about their presence and the importance of preventive measures. With over 30,000 of them inhabiting the waters near the San Gabriel River alone, the need for education and awareness is clear.
